**Q: Where do crash reports from the Lumivale app actually go?**

When the app crashes, the Brackenfall SDK captures a minidump and queues it locally until the device regains connectivity. Reports are then batched, symbolicated on the Thornway cluster, and deduplicated before landing in triage queues. Please don't assume delivery is instant; batching can take up to an hour. The full pipeline diagram and retry semantics are documented on the internal page below.

operations page: https://jira.qorvelsys.internal/browse/pages/browse/pages

Step 4: Deploy the orphaned-resource sweeper to the Brindlemoor cluster. Dry-run first; review the candidate list for anything tagged keep-forever. Sweeper deletes unattached volumes and stale load balancers older than 14 days. If counts look wrong, halt and escalate to the Tovey platform rotation. The sweeper bundle must be signed before rollout; use the deploy key below.

deploy key for kajof-fajop: bky6_gDHw9Q

**CI note: locale-dependent date formatting failures**

If the Thornvale pipeline fails on the date-formatting suite, check whether the runner image reverted to its default locale. The tests assert day-month ordering for the Vestrian and Kolmark locales, and a bare image renders both identically, producing false failures. Do not skip the suite — instead re-pin the locale layer in the runner config and re-trigger. Confirm the fix against the exact runner image noted below.

build token for tawip-yageg: htk9_92ac43d42